http://blog.csdn.net/u013686019/article/details/52856389
OkHttp通过Https方式访问服务器时需要验证一些证书,如果证书有问题,网络访问失败,Log信息:
java.security.cert.CertPathValidatorException: Trust anchor for certification path not found.
为了避免在本地安装一连串证书的麻烦(尤其对于测试环境),我们可以设置 OkHttp,让它信任所有证书。
之前在网上进行了大量搜索,好不容易找到正确的设置方式,特此记录下。
1、实现X509TrustManager接口:
private static class TrustAllCerts implements X509TrustManager {
@Override
publi